Solitude

Jenn Tenn 1967 (New York)



Living alone seems easier than getting along with another.
Emptiness fills your heart,
It takes little courage to live alone.
Yes! You can do as you please,
When you live alone.
You're responsible for just you.
Feelings of freedom seem abundant,
And yet just out of reach.
When you live with someone,
You're now responsible for each other.
And freedom abounds for the burden of life's decisions is shared.
